    In this question, two statements are given followed by three conclusions. Choose the conclusion(s) which best fit(s) logically.
    Statements:
    1) No soap is tree.
    2) All trees are roads.
    Conclusions:
    I. Some trees are roads.
    II. All roads are trees.
    III. No road is soap.

    A.

    Only conclusion III follows

    B.

    Only conclusion II follows

    C.

    Only conclusion I follows

    D.

    All conclusions follow

    Correct option is C

    Conclusions:
    I. Some trees are roads. (True, all tress are road then definitely some also be the roads)
    II. All roads are trees. (False, there is no information about the part of roads which is outside the tree)
    III. No road is soap (False, outer part of roads which is not in trees can me soaps so negative conclusion is wrong without no information)
    Only conclusion I follows
